Xây dựng Skills cho Claude — Phần 4: Phân phối và Chia sẻ
Điểm nổi bật
Nhấn để đến mục tương ứng
- 1 Bước 2: Triển khai cấp team Nếu tổ chức dùng Claude Teams/Enterprise, deploy qua organization-level skills.
- 2 Ví dụ: một công ty phần mềm có thể triển khai skill "code-review" và "sprint-planning" cho toàn bộ đội ngũ engineering, đảm bảo mọi người tuân theo...
- 3 Giống như MCP, họ tin rằng skills nên portable giữa các công cụ và nền tảng.
- 4 Cùng một skill có thể hoạt động dù bạn đang dùng Claude hay các nền tảng AI khác.
- 5 Sử dụng Skills qua API Với các use case lập trình -- xây dựng ứng dụng, agent, hoặc quy trình tự động -- API cung cấp quyền kiểm soát trực tiếp về ...
Serial: Hướng dẫn toàn diện xây dựng Skills cho Claude | Phần 4/6
Dịch và biên soạn từ "The Complete Guide to Building Skills for Claude" của Anthropic.
Bạn đã xây dựng và test skill thành công ở Phần 3. Giờ là lúc đưa skill đến tay người dùng. Bài viết này hướng dẫn mô hình phân phối, cách sử dụng qua API, và chiến lược định vị skill của bạn.
Mô hình phân phối hiện tại
Cho người dùng cá nhân
Quy trình cài đặt skill hiện tại gồm 4 bước:
- Tải thư mục skill về
- Nén thành file zip (nếu cần)
- Upload lên Claude.ai qua Settings > Capabilities > Skills
- Hoặc đặt vào thư mục skills của Claude Code
Cho tổ chức (Organization-level)
Anthropic đã ra mắt tính năng triển khai skill cấp tổ chức từ tháng 12/2025:
- Admin có thể deploy skill cho toàn bộ workspace
- Cập nhật tự động cho tất cả thành viên
- Quản lý tập trung
Đây là tính năng đặc biệt hữu ích cho các công ty Việt Nam muốn chuẩn hoá cách team sử dụng Claude. Ví dụ: một công ty phần mềm có thể triển khai skill "code-review" và "sprint-planning" cho toàn bộ đội ngũ engineering, đảm bảo mọi người tuân theo cùng một quy trình.
Open Standard: Tiêu chuẩn mở
Anthropic đã công bố Agent Skills như một tiêu chuẩn mở. Giống như MCP, họ tin rằng skills nên portable giữa các công cụ và nền tảng. Cùng một skill có thể hoạt động dù bạn đang dùng Claude hay các nền tảng AI khác.
Tuy nhiên, một số skill được thiết kế để tận dụng tối đa khả năng của một nền tảng cụ thể. Tác giả có thể ghi chú điều này trong trường compatibility của skill.
Sử dụng Skills qua API
Với các use case lập trình -- xây dựng ứng dụng, agent, hoặc quy trình tự động -- API cung cấp quyền kiểm soát trực tiếp về quản lý và thực thi skill.
Khả năng chính
- Endpoint
/v1/skillsđể liệt kê và quản lý skills - Thêm skills vào Messages API requests qua tham số
container.skills - Quản lý phiên bản qua Claude Console
- Hoạt động với Claude Agent SDK để xây dựng agent tuỳ chỉnh
Khi nào dùng API, khi nào dùng Claude.ai?
| Use Case | Nền tảng phù hợp |
|---|---|
| Người dùng cuối tương tác trực tiếp với skills | Claude.ai / Claude Code |
| Testing thủ công và iteration trong quá trình phát triển | Claude.ai / Claude Code |
| Quy trình cá nhân, ad-hoc | Claude.ai / Claude Code |
| Ứng dụng sử dụng skills theo chương trình | API |
| Triển khai production quy mô lớn | API |
| Pipeline tự động và hệ thống agent | API |
Lưu ý quan trọng: Skills trong API yêu cầu Code Execution Tool beta, cung cấp môi trường bảo mật mà skills cần để chạy.
Tài liệu kỹ thuật
- Skills API Quickstart
- Create Custom Skills
- Skills in the Agent SDK
Hosting trên GitHub: Cách tiếp cận được khuyến nghị
Anthropic khuyến nghị bắt đầu bằng việc host skill trên GitHub:
Bước 1: Tạo repository GitHub
- Repo public cho skill mã nguồn mở
- README rõ ràng với hướng dẫn cài đặt (README ở cấp repo, KHÔNG đặt trong thư mục skill)
- Ví dụ sử dụng kèm screenshots
Bước 2: Tài liệu trong MCP Repo
- Liên kết đến skills từ tài liệu MCP
- Giải thích giá trị khi dùng cả hai cùng nhau
- Cung cấp quick-start guide
Bước 3: Tạo Installation Guide
## Cai dat skill [Ten Dich Vu]
1. Tai skill:
- Clone repo: git clone https://github.com/yourcompany/skills
- Hoac tai ZIP tu Releases
2. Cai dat trong Claude:
- Mo Claude.ai > Settings > Skills
- Nhan "Upload skill"
- Chon thu muc skill (da nen zip)
3. Kich hoat skill:
- Bat skill [Ten Dich Vu]
- Dam bao MCP server da ket noi
4. Test:
- Hoi Claude: "Thiet lap du an moi trong [Ten Dich Vu]"
Định vị Skill: Outcomes thay vì Features
Cách bạn mô tả skill quyết định liệu người dùng có hiểu giá trị và thực sự dùng thử hay không. Khi viết về skill trong README, tài liệu, hay marketing, hãy tuân theo các nguyên tắc sau:
Tập trung vào kết quả, không phải tính năng
# Tot
"Skill ProjectHub giup team thiet lap workspace du an hoan chinh
trong vai giay — bao gom pages, databases, va templates — thay
vi mat 30 phut setup thu cong."
# Te
"Skill ProjectHub la thu muc chua YAML frontmatter va huong dan
Markdown goi cac cong cu MCP server."
Nhấn mạnh câu chuyện MCP + Skills
"MCP server cua chung toi cho phep Claude truy cap du an Linear.
Skills cua chung toi day Claude quy trinh lap ke hoach sprint
cua team ban. Ket hop lai, chung tao nen quan ly du an
bang AI."
Ví dụ thực tế: Phân phối skill cho team Việt Nam
Giả sử bạn xây dựng skill "shopify-theme-setup" cho agency của mình:
Bước 1: Phát triển và test nội bộ
Cài đặt thủ công cho 2-3 developer senior, thu thập feedback trong 1-2 tuần.
Bước 2: Triển khai cấp team
Nếu tổ chức dùng Claude Teams/Enterprise, deploy qua organization-level skills. Nếu không, tạo repo GitHub internal và hướng dẫn cài đặt.
Bước 3: Chia sẻ cộng đồng
Nếu skill có giá trị chung, public repo trên GitHub, viết bài blog giới thiệu, chia sẻ trên các cộng đồng developer Việt Nam.
Bước 4: Duy trì và cập nhật
Theo dõi issue trên GitHub, cập nhật version trong metadata, thông báo thay đổi cho người dùng.
Chiến lược phân phối theo quy mô
| Quy mô | Kênh phân phối | Ưu tiên |
|---|---|---|
| Cá nhân | Cài đặt thủ công | Đơn giản, nhanh |
| Team nhỏ (2-10) | GitHub repo + hướng dẫn | Nhất quán, dễ cập nhật |
| Team lớn (10-50) | Organization-level deployment | Quản lý tập trung, tự động |
| Cộng đồng | Public GitHub + marketing | Reach, adoption |
| Enterprise | API + custom deployment | Kiểm soát, bảo mật, scale |
Lưu ý bảo mật khi phân phối
- Không đưa API key hay credentials vào skill
- Sử dụng biến môi trường cho thông tin nhạy cảm
- Review code trong scripts/ trước khi chia sẻ
- Ghi rõ quyền truy cập cần thiết trong README
- Cân nhắc dùng license phù hợp (MIT cho mã nguồn mở, proprietary cho nội bộ)
Tổng kết Phần 4
Bạn đã nắm được:
- Mô hình phân phối: cá nhân, tổ chức, và cộng đồng
- Agent Skills là tiêu chuẩn mở, portable giữa các nền tảng
- Cách sử dụng Skills qua API cho production deployment
- Hosting trên GitHub với installation guide
- Định vị skill theo outcomes thay vì features
- Câu chuyện MCP + Skills
Trong Phần 5, chúng ta sẽ đi vào phần thực chiến nhất: 5 patterns thiết kế skill phổ biến và cách xử lý các lỗi thường gặp.
Đọc tiếp serial
- Phần 1: Giới thiệu và Cơ bản
- Phần 2: Thiết kế và Lập kế hoạch
- Phần 3: Testing và Tối ưu
- Phần 4: Phân phối và Chia sẻ (bạn đang đọc)
- Phần 5: Patterns và Troubleshooting
- Phần 6: Tài liệu tham khảo và Checklist
Bai viet co huu ich khong?
Bản quyền thuộc về tác giả. Vui lòng dẫn nguồn khi chia sẻ.









